Frequently Asked Questions about Waterloo Uptown Apartments with EV Charging

How much is the average rent for Waterloo Uptown Apartments with EV Charging?

The average rent for a Apartment in Waterloo Uptown with EV Charging is $1,945.

What is the largest Waterloo Uptown Apartment for rent with EV Charging?

Today's Apartment with EV Charging and the most square footage in Waterloo Uptown is a 1,267 square feet unit starting from $1,705 at Richmond Square.

What is the average size for Waterloo Uptown Apartments for rent with EV Charging?

The average size for a rental with EV Charging in Waterloo Uptown is currently at 604 sq ft.
